Picture boxes can be touchy. Sunlight is always the best. Brings out the true colors and shades of the paint.
Picture boxes work fine but you must use what they call 'daylight lamps' which have a Kelvin value equal to real daylight , if you don't have adequate lighting your picture box is next to useless as these exterior photos prove.
